WORDS PH I L RHODES T he biggest single-source LED movie light currently made is rated at around 3KW. The biggest HMIs are 24KW. That means that LED has some way to go before it can completely replace the gear that’s been in use for decades. 575W HMIs are the smallest common type and perhaps something of a watershed: once LED has started to compete at that level, the technology will really be coming of age. Matching 575W HMI, however, would require something not much less than a 575W LED, and a 575W single- emitter LED hard light has long been a tough thing to make. Even so, looking at some representative specimens from IBC2019, it’s clear that the race to do that is well underway. ARRI ORBITER The entrance to IBC’s Hall 12 this year was guarded by Arri’s Orbiter. The company has a lot of experience in LED hard light, having been early to offer a range of Fresnels, though the Orbiter is more complex – perhaps an attempt to create a light that’s all things to all people. The promotional material mentions “sheer output” as a feature, and while the power level is more

or less similar to an L10 Fresnel at around 500W, with the efficient, open-faced reflectors, the Orbiter should liberate more photons overall. Like anything at this power level, the Orbiter is just about usable away from a mains socket, requiring 48V input from a big floor-standing block battery. With a more cynical eye, it’s also a light with the sort of interchangeable optical components – reflectors, diffusers and so on – that have been available from other manufacturers for a while, though not with full colour mixing and not at this power level (though see the upcoming Hive Super Hornet). Speaking of colour, among the controls is an option to select by CIE xy coordinate, a welcome option found mainly at the high end, which should make it easier to colour match different lights. The reflectors closely approximate a PAR and, like any PAR, the beam is not as clean as that from a Fresnel. It does seem a little cleaner than an HMI-based PAR, possibly because the hexagonal LED array is a more consistently illuminated source. There are also projection (profile or ellipsoidal) adapters, dome and panel diffusers. It will do more or less anything, though we don’t yet know what it’ll cost.
